The ingredients needed to make Cajun Shrimp Enchiladas:
  1. Make ready 4 Lbs Shrimp (raw, peeled, and deveined)
  2. Prepare 1 Onion (diced)
  3. Make ready 3 cloves Garlic (minced)
  4. Take 2 Tbs Jalapeños
  5. Make ready 6 Tbs Butter
  6. Prepare 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  7. Make ready 3 Cup Chicken Broth
  8. Take 10 Oz can Tomatoes (diced)
  9. Prepare 3 Tbs Cajun Seasoning
  10. Get 1 tsp Chili Powder
  11. Prepare 1/2 tsp Cayenne Pepper
  12. Make ready 1/2 tsp Garlic Powder
  13. Get 1 pkg Cream cheese (8 Oz)
  14. Make ready 1 lb Monterey Jack Cheese (grated)
  15. Make ready 10 large Tortillas

Instructions to make Cajun Shrimp Enchiladas:
  1. In a large Skillet, saute onion, garlic, and jalapeno in butter until tender. Stir in flour until blended. Gradually stir in broth until a nice Roux is formed.
  2. Bring to a slow boil, reduce heat and add the shrimp, tomatoes, and seasonings. When shrimp is starting to turn slightly pink, stirring cream cheese and shredded cheese and cook until melted
  3. Remove approximately 2 cups and set aside for later as a topping.
  4. Spoon approximately three quarter cup down the center of each tortilla. Fold ends and roll up. Place on baking sheets lined with parchment paper, ensure a small space between each tortilla. Bake at 350°F for 20 minutes
  5. Plate enchiladas, and spoon some of the mixture that was set aside on top.
